Enhance Process Flow and Store Management with Node Handling Improvements
- Added functionality to handle node additions from drag & drop in ProcessFlowCanvas, ensuring immediate visual feedback and persistence in application state. - Implemented logic in the process store to prevent duplicate nodes when adding new nodes from the canvas. - Enhanced server-side logging to track process updates, including node and edge counts for better debugging. - Improved node extraction logic in the process builder store to create placeholder nodes from edge references when no nodes are present. - Added debug logging for saving process data to facilitate better tracking of changes in the application state.
